自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 问答 (1)
  • 收藏
  • 关注

原创 工作小记1

1.ping+域名 可以得到当前网站的IP地址比如:ping baidu.com;2.利用DecimalFormat可以对数据进行指定格式处理。Decimalformat format = new DecimalFormat("00");sout(format.format(21.467)); //结果是21

2023-01-06 16:07:55 107

原创 下班路上小记

看了一篇for loop和for each两种循环性能的比较,如果集合是ArrayList,数据量大的情况下,for loop用时短;如果集合是LinkedList,推荐使用 for each.

2022-06-28 19:06:33 112

原创 Nginx篇

简述一下什么是Nginx,它有什么优势和功能?Nginx是一个web服务器和方向代理服务器,用于HTTP/HTTPS/SMTP/POP3/MAP协议。因它的稳定性、丰富的功能集、示例配置文件和低系统资源的消耗而闻名。优点:(1)更快这表现在两个方面:一方面,在正常情况下,单次请求会得到更快的响应;另一方面,在高峰期(如有数万计的并发请求),Nginx可以比其他Web服务器更快的响应请求。(2)高扩展性,跨平台Nginx的设计极具扩展性,它完全是由多个不同功能、不同层次、不同类型且耦合度极低的.

2022-03-03 11:02:58 2180

原创 2021-08-27

工作小记String str = "3111";System.out.println("1" == str.subtring(1,2); //falseSystem.out.println("1".equals(str.substring(1,2)); //true

2021-08-27 18:21:45 89

原创 2021-07-05

标题日常记录(POI)描述:因为手动更改Excel的扩展名(.xls–>.xlsx或.xlsx–>.xls),导致创建workbook对象时拋异常。解决:利用poi的FileMagic方式判断文件真正的文件类型,从而达到过滤的地步。简单示例:// 此时的test.xls是由test.xlsx修改后缀得来的File file = new File(“D:\test.xls”);// 获取文件类型FileMagic fm = File magic.valueOf(file);// 打

2021-07-05 20:01:24 79

原创 2021-05-11

处理Java日期时,YYYY格式设置的问题日常开发中,我们经常需要处理日期。我们要当时日期格式化的时候,年份是大写YYYY的坑。Calendar calendar = Calendar.getInstance();calendar.set(2019, Calendar.DECEMBER, 31);Date testDate = calendar.getTime();SimpleDateFormat dtf = new SimpleDateFormat(“YYYY-MM-dd”);System.o

2021-05-11 09:03:15 68

原创 2020-12-25

背景:实体类的某字段是Date类型,ORACLE数据库对应字段的type也是Date类型,框架Mybatis。应用:实体类此字段赋值new Date(), mybatis映射文件直接用#{此变量名}即可拿到这个值,若需要加,只可判断为非null,不可加非空判断,否则会报错....

2020-12-25 19:42:56 80

原创 2020-09-02

JavaScript进阶学习##DOM简单学习:* 功能:控制html文档的内容* 获取页面标签(元素)对象:Element* document.getElementById(“id值”):通过元素的id获取元素对象* 操作Element对象:1. 修改属性值:1. 明确获取的对象是哪一个?2. 查看API文档,找其中有哪些属性可以设置2. 修改标签体内容:* 属性:innerHTML1. 获取元素对象2. 使用innerHTML属性修改标签体内容## 事件简单学习* 功能: 某

2020-09-02 19:14:24 130

原创 2020-08-31

git revert 与 git reset的区别git reset(一般用于本地提交后的撤回)回退到指定的commit版本,指定commit版本之后的commit都将被重置git reset --soft xxx 用于将文件提交至本地仓库后撤回暂存区的操作git reset --mixed xxx 用于将本地仓库文件撤回至工作区,具体操作参照git reset --softgit reset --hard xxx 会将工作区、暂存区、本地仓库的所有提交的文件全都撤销(包括工作区文件,会删除)g

2020-08-31 18:22:26 140

原创 2020-08-17

Struts2的<s:token>防止表单重复提交表单重复提交的现象:由于服务器缓慢或者网速原因,重复点击按钮已经提交成功,刷新成功页面提交成功后,通过回退,再次点击提交按钮表单重复提交的根本原因:没有完整的进行一个请求,而是分成两个不完整请求进行,第一个请求到表单页面,第二个提交表单数据到后台的请求。<s:token>原理使用token标签的时候,Struts2会建立一个GUID(全局唯一的字符串)放在session中,并且会成为一个hidden放在form中。

2020-08-17 22:20:56 139

原创 JavaScript初步认识

## JavaScript: * 概念: 一门客户端脚本语言 * 运行在客户端浏览器中的。每一个浏览器都有JavaScript的解析引擎 * 脚本语言:不需要编译,直接就可以被浏览器解析执行了 * 功能: * 可以来增强用户和html页面的交互过程,可以来控制html元素,让页面有一些动态的效果,增强用户的体验。 * JavaScript发展史: 1. 1992年,Nombase公司,开发出第一门客户端脚本语言,专门用于表单的校验。命名为 : C-- ,后来更名为:ScriptE

2020-07-23 21:06:10 142

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除